Democrats do much better with Red States when they have someone who can use their simple dialect. Bill Clinton was a master at it. Of course Dubya thrived on it.

Obama was too 'uppity' sounding for them, which of course was not a fault on his part. For as much as I admired his slow thoughtful responses that dissected the opposition so efficiently to those who appreciated it, there were those that take that as talking down to them (especially from an AA) Hillary just wasn't a great communicator period and came off as that teachers pet who always got A's and sat in the front row. Bernie did better because he stuck to a limited number of talking points that he hammered home. But he still wasn't high on the "ah shucks" register.

I think we need.....even if it is all put on for the camera and crowd......someone who can use that simpleton language and inflection, and be able to explain how their problems are generated from Republicans, and how Democrats will help them. I don't care if you want to call it crass or hypocritical or underhanded. If that is the only way to reach these folks then so be it.

Too often Democratic leadership ASSUME that its just the message they need to get out, and the way they get it out does not matter because the message is the obvious correct one. And that people will somehow just get smarter and realize that eventually.

The medium is the message.
